HR 13035 · 94th Congress · Education

Sea Grant Program Improvement Act of 1976

Introduced 1976-04-05· Sponsored by Rep. Rogers, Paul G. [D-FL-11]· House

Latest: Public law 94-461.(1976-10-08)

Plain Language Summary

[AI summary unavailable — showing source text] Amends the National Sea Grant College and Program Act of 1966 by authorizing the appropriation of $50,000,000 for Sea Grant Colleges and Marine Science Development. Authorizes the Secretary of Commerce to support and encourage the advancement of research and development capabilities of other nations relating to the exploration, conservation, and management of marine resources. Authorizes the Secretary to support the funding of education and training of foreign nationals through sea grant colleges and other suitable institutes and agencies of the United States. Authorizes the appropriation of $3,000,000 for fiscal year 1977 to carry out such provisions. Authorizes the appropriation of $5,000,000 for fiscal year 1977 to enable the Secretary to enter into contracts with, or make grants to, specified organizations for purposes of conducting activities of a national scope and concern appropriate in assisting him in carrying out programs relating to the development, conservation, utilization, management, and protection of the marine environment.…
